The Nature of the Scam

This number has garnered attention for its association with a deceptive scam designed to exploit users' fears about computer security. Victims have described receiving unsolicited messages or pop-up notifications alleging that their devices are infected with viruses. These messages create a sense of urgency, prompting users to dial the listed number without critically assessing its legitimacy.

Upon contacting 1800 015 972 / 00015972, complaints suggest that individuals on the other end of the line are quick to request sensitive information and encourage downloads of remote access programs, such as TeamViewer. This strategy is a common tactic used by scammers to gain illegal access to a person’s computer, allowing them to manipulate files, steal personal data, or coerce victims into purchasing fake antivirus software that provides no real protection.

How to Handle Calls from 1800 015 972

  • Do Not Engage: If you receive a call or notification directing you to this number, do not engage or provide any personal information.
  • Ignore Alerts: If you see messages claiming your computer is at risk, these are typically scam attempts. Your device is likely not compromised.
  • Use Security Software: Ensure your antivirus software is up to date, and run regular checks on your computer for added peace of mind.
  • Report the Number: If contacted through this number, consider reporting it to the relevant authorities or through platforms like Reverseau to warn others.
